06-WLAN QoS命令
本章节下载: 06-WLAN QoS命令 (159.42 KB)
文中的AP指的是带无线接入功能的路由器。
cac policy命令用来配置开启CAC(Connect Admission Control,连接准入控制)功能后使用的接入控制策略。
undo cac policy命令用来恢复缺省情况。
【命令】
cac policy { channelutilization [ channelutilization-value ] | client [ client-number ] }
undo cac policy
【缺省情况】
使用基于客户端数量的CAC策略,客户端数量为20。
【视图】
Radio接口视图
【缺省用户角色】
network-admin
【参数】
channelutilization:CAC使用基于信道利用率的准入策略。
channelutilization-value:允许接入的信道最大利用率,取值范围为0~100,为百分比形式,缺省值为65%。
client:CAC使用基于客户端数量的准入策略。
client-number:允许接入的客户端的最大个数,取值范围为0~124。
【使用指导】
CAC功能只对AC-VO和AC-VI队列有效。
CAC准入策略有下面两种:
· 基于信道利用率的准入策略:计算单位时间内所有已接入的高优先级AC占用信道的时间百分比,以及请求以高优先级接入的AC占用信道的时间百分比,二者相加,如果小于或等于用户配置的最大信道占用时间百分比,则允许AC以请求的优先级接入。否则,拒绝其使用请求的高优先级AC。
· 基于用户数量的准入策略:如果高优先级AC中客户端数量加上请求接入的客户端,小于或等于用户配置的该高优先级AC的最大用户数,则允许客户端的请求。否则,拒绝其使用请求的高优先级AC。
当单独或同时指定队列AC-VO、AC-VI的流量开启CAC功能时,如果客户端申请AC失败,设备会根据客户端携带的优先级字段,对其进行降级至AC-BE处理。
【举例】
# 开启CAC功能,使用基于信道利用率的准入策略,允许接入的信道最大利用率为70%。
<Sysname> system-view
[Sysname] interface wlan-radio 0/0
[Sysname-WLAN-Radio0/0] cac policy channelutilization 70
display wlan wmm命令用来显示WMM的统计信息。
【命令】
display wlan wmm { client [ interface wlan-radio interface-number | mac-address mac-address ] | radio [ interface wlan-radio interface-number ] }
【视图】
任意视图
【缺省用户角色】
network-admin
network-operator
【参数】
client:显示WMM客户端的统计信息。在AC设备上,不指定ap和mac-address参数表示显示所有WMM客户端的统计信息。在FAT AP设备上,不指定interface wlan-radio和mac-address参数表示显示所有WMM客户端的统计信息。
radio:显示WMM射频的统计信息。在AC设备上,不指定ap参数表示显示所有WMM射频的统计信息。在FAT AP设备上,不指定interface wlan-radio参数表示显示所有WMM射频的统计信息。
mac-address mac-address:显示指定MAC地址的WMM客户端统计信息,mac-address格式为H-H-H。
interface wlan-radio interface-number:显示指定射频接口的WMM客户端/WMM射频统计信息。
【举例】
# 显示WMM射频统计信息。
<Sysname> display wlan wmm radio
Radio : 1
Client EDCA updates : 0
QoS mode :WMM
WMM status :Enabled
Radio max AIFSN : 15 Radio max ECWmin : 10
Radio max TXOPLimit : 32767 Radio max ECWmax : 10
CAC information
Clients accepted : 0
Voice : 0
Video : 0
Total request medium time(µs) : 0
Voice(µs) : 0
Video(µs) : 0
Calls rejected due to insufficient resources : 0
Calls rejected due to invalid parameters : 0
Calls rejected due to invalid medium time : 0
Calls rejected due to invalid delay bound : 0
Radio : 2
Client EDCA updates : 0
QoS mode :WMM
WMM status :Disabled
Radio max AIFSN : 15 Radio max ECWmin : 10
Radio max TXOPLimit : 32767 Radio max ECWmax : 10
CAC information
Client accepted : 0
Voice : 0
Video : 0
Total request medium time(µs) : 0
Voice(µs) : 0
Video(µs) : 0
Calls rejected due to insufficient resources : 0
Calls rejected due to invalid parameters : 0
Calls rejected due to invalid medium time : 0
Calls rejected due to invalid delay bound : 0
表1-1 display wlan wmm radio命令显示信息描述表
字段 |
描述 |
Radio |
Radio标识 |
Client EDCA updates |
客户端EDCA参数更新次数 |
QoS mode |
QoS模式: · WMM:QoS模式为WMM · N/A:QoS模式不可用 |
WMM status |
WMM功能开启状态,取值包括: · Enabled:WMM功能处于开启状态 · Disabled:WMM功能处于关闭状态 |
Radio max AIFSN |
Radio支持的AIFSN值的最大值 |
Radio max ECWmin |
Radio支持的ECWmin值的最大值 |
Radio max TXOPLimit |
Radio支持的TXOPLimit值的最大值 |
Radio max ECWmax |
Radio支持的ECWmax值的最大值 |
CAC information |
CAC信息 |
Clients accepted |
Radio下已准入的Client数量,包括AC-VO队列下和AC-VI队列下准入的Client数量 |
Total request medium time |
所有队列申请的时间,包括AC-VO队列下和AC-VI队列下申请的时间,单位为微秒 |
Calls rejected due to insufficient resource |
因资源不足拒绝的请求数量 |
Calls rejected due to invalid parameters |
因参数无效拒绝的请求数量 |
Calls rejected due to invalid medium time |
因接入时间无效拒绝的请求数量 |
Calls rejected due to invalid delay bound |
因延迟时间无效拒绝的请求数量 |
# 显示所有客户端的WMM统计信息。
<Sysname> display wlan wmm client
MAC address : 000f-e23c-0001 SSID : service
QoS mode : WMM
APSD information :
Max SP length : 7
L: Legacy T: Trigger D: Delivery
AC AC-BK AC-BE AC-VI AC-VO
Assoc State T|D L T|D T|D
Statistics information :
Uplink packets : 0 Downlink packets : 0
Uplink bytes : 0 Downlink bytes : 0
Downgrade packets : 0 Discarded packets : 0
Downgrade bytes : 0 Discarded bytes : 0
TS information :
AC : AC-VO User priority : 7
TID : 1 Direction : Bidirectional
PSB : 0 Surplus bandwidth allowance : 1.0000
Medium time (µs) : 39 MSDU size (bytes) : 1500
Mean data rate (Kbps) : 10.000 Minimum PHY rate (Mbps) : 11.000
TS creation time : 0h:0m:5s
TS updating time : 0h:0m:5s
Uplink TS packets : 0 Downlink TS packets : 0
Uplink TS bytes : 0 Downlink TS bytes : 0
表1-2 display wlan wmm client命令显示信息描述表
字段 |
描述 |
MAC address |
Client的MAC地址 |
SSID |
SSID名 |
QoS mode |
QoS模式: · WMM:QoS模式为WMM · N/A:QoS模式不可用 |
APSD information |
APSD信息 |
Max SP length |
最大服务时间(Service period)长度 |
AC |
接入类: · AC-VO:语音队列 · AC-VI:视频队列 · AC-BE:尽力而为队列 · AC-BK:背景队列 |
Assoc state |
Client接入时指定的AC的APSD属性: · T:表示本AC有trigger-enabled属性 · D:表示本AC有delivery-enabled属性 · T | D:表示上面的两个属性都有 · L:表示本AC有Legacy属性 |
Statistics information |
数据流量统计信息 |
Uplink packets |
上行报文数 |
Uplink bytes |
上行字节数 |
Downlink packets |
下行报文数 |
Downlink bytes |
下行字节数 |
Downgrade packets |
降级处理的报文数 |
Discarded packets |
丢弃处理的报文数 |
Downgrade bytes |
降级处理的字节数 |
Discarded bytes |
丢弃处理的字节数 |
TS information |
传输流信息 |
User priority |
用户优先级(来自有线网络的报文) |
TID |
传输流标识,取值范围为0~15 |
Direction |
流方向,取值包括: · Uplink:上行 · Downlink:下行 · Bidirectional:双向 |
PSB |
省电模式标识(power save behavior): · 1表示U-APSD节能模式 · 0表示传统省电模式 |
Surplus bandwidth allowance |
允许富余带宽(百分比) |
Medium time |
允许进入媒体信道的时间,单位为微秒 |
MSDU size |
平均报文大小,单位为字节 |
Mean data rate |
平均数据传输速率,单位为Kbps |
Minimum PHY rate |
最小物理传输速率,单位为Mbps |
TS creation time |
创建传输流的时间 |
TS updating time |
更新传输流的时间 |
Uplink TS packets |
上行传输流的报文数 |
Uplink TS bytes |
上行传输流的字节数 |
Downlink TS packets |
下行传输流的报文数 |
Downlink TS bytes |
下行传输流的字节数 |
【相关命令】
· reset wlan wmm
edca client命令用来配置射频和客户端的协商参数。
undo edca client命令用来恢复缺省情况。
【命令】
edca client { ac-be | ac-bk } { aifsn aifsn-value | ecw ecwmin ecwmin-value ecwmax ecwmax-value | txoplimit txoplimit-value } *
undo edca client { ac-be | ac-bk }
【缺省情况】
如表1-3所示。
表1-3 Radio和客户端的协商参数的缺省值
AC |
AIFSN |
ECWmin |
ECWmax |
TXOP Limit |
AC-BK |
7 |
4 |
10 |
0 |
AC-BE |
3 |
4 |
10 |
0 |
【视图】
Radio接口视图
【缺省用户角色】
network-admin
【参数】
ac-be:AC-BE(尽力而为流)优先级队列。
ac-bk:AC-BK(背景流)优先级队列。
aifsn aifsn-value:仲裁帧间隙数,取值范围为2~15。
ecwmin ecwmin-value:最小竞争窗口指数形式,取值范围为0~15。
ecwmax ecwmax-value:最大竞争窗口指数形式,取值范围为0~15。ecwmax值必须大于等于ecwmin值。
txoplimit txoplimit-value:传输机会限制,以32微秒为单位,取值范围为0~65535。取值为0表示只允许传输一个MPDU。
【使用指导】
如果所有客户端都是802.11b客户端,建议AC-BK、AC-BE的TXOP Limit参数配置为0。
如果同时存在802.11b客户端和802.11g客户端,建议AC-BK、AC-BE的TXOP Limit参数使用缺省值。
【举例】
# 配置AC-BE的AIFSN值为5。
<Sysname> system-view
[Sysname] interface wlan-radio 0/0
[Sysname-WLAN-Radio0/0] edca client ac-be aifsn 5
edca client命令用来配置射频和客户端的协商参数。
undo edca client命令用来恢复缺省情况。
【命令】
edca client { ac-vi | ac-vo } { aifsn aifsn-value | cac { disable | enable } | ecw ecwmin ecwmin-value ecwmax ecwmax-value | txoplimit txoplimit-value } *
undo edca client { ac-vi | ac-vo }
【缺省情况】
如表1-4所示。
表1-4 Radio和客户端的协商参数的缺省值
AC |
AIFSN |
ECWmin |
ECWmax |
TXOP Limit |
AC-VI |
2 |
3 |
4 |
94 |
AC-VO |
2 |
2 |
3 |
47 |
【视图】
Radio接口视图
【缺省用户角色】
network-admin
【参数】
ac-vi:AC-VI(视频流)优先级队列。
ac-vo:AC-VO(语音流)优先级队列。
aifsn aifsn-value:仲裁帧间隙数,取值范围为2~15。
cac:客户端使用连接准入控制的开关。AC-VO和AC-VI支持CAC,缺省为关闭。
disable:关闭客户端使用连接准入控制。
enable:开启客户端使用连接准入控制。
ecwmin ecwmin-value:最小竞争窗口指数形式,取值范围为0~15。
ecwmax ecwmax-value:最大竞争窗口指数形式,取值范围为0~15。ecwmax值必须大于等于ecwmin值。
txoplimit txoplimit-value:传输机会限制,以32微秒为单位,取值范围为0~65535。取值为0表示只允许传输一个MPDU。
【使用指导】
如果所有客户端都是802.11b客户端,建议AC-VI、AC-VO的TXOP Limit参数配置为188、102。
如果同时存在802.11b客户端和802.11g客户端,建议AC-VI、AC-VO的TXOP Limit参数使用缺省值。
【举例】
# 配置AC-VO的AIFSN值为3。
<Sysname> system-view
[Sysname] interface wlan-radio 0/0
[Sysname-WLAN-Radio0/0] edca client ac-vo aifsn 3
edca radio命令用来配置射频的EDCA工作参数。
undo edca radio命令用来恢复缺省情况。
【命令】
edca radio { ac-be | ac-bk | ac-vi | ac-vo } { ack-policy { noack | normalack } | aifsn aifsn-value | ecw ecwmin ecwmin-value ecwmax ecwmax-value | txoplimit txoplimit-value } *
undo edca radio { ac-be | ac-bk | ac-vi | ac-vo }
【缺省情况】
如表1-5所示。
表1-5 射频的EDCA工作参数缺省值
AC |
AIFSN |
ECWmin |
ECWmax |
TXOP Limit |
AC-BK |
7 |
4 |
10 |
0 |
AC-BE |
3 |
4 |
6 |
0 |
AC-VI |
1 |
3 |
4 |
94 |
AC-VO |
1 |
2 |
3 |
47 |
【视图】
Radio接口视图
【缺省用户角色】
network-admin
【参数】
ac-be:AC-BE(尽力而为流)优先级队列。
ac-bk:AC-BK(背景流)优先级队列。
ac-vi:AC-VI(视频流)优先级队列。
ac-vo:AC-VO(语音流)优先级队列。
ack-policy:指定AC使用的ACK策略。
noack:指定AC使用的ACK策略是No ACK。缺省ACK策略为Normal ACK。
normalack:指定AC使用的ACK策略是Normal ACK。缺省ACK策略为Normal ACK。
aifsn aifsn-value:仲裁帧间隙数,取值范围为1~15。
ecwmin ecwmin-value:最小竞争窗口指数形式,取值范围为0~10。
ecwmax ecwmax-value:最大竞争窗口指数形式,取值范围为0~10。ecwmax值必须大于等于ecwmin值。
txoplimit txoplimit-value:EDCA的TXOP Limit参数,以32微秒为单位,取值范围为0~32767,取值为0表示只允许传输一个MPDU。
【举例】
# 配置Radio使用的AC-VO队列的AIFSN值为2。
<Sysname> system-view
[Sysname] interface wlan-radio 0/0
[Sysname-WLAN-Radio0/0] edca radio ac-vo aifsn 2
qos priority命令用来配置端口优先级。
undo qos priority命令用来恢复缺省情况。
【命令】
qos priority priority-value
undo qos priority
【缺省情况】
端口优先级为0。
【视图】
无线服务模板视图
【缺省用户角色】
network-admin
【参数】
priority-value:端口优先级,取值范围为0~7。取值越大优先级越高。
【使用指导】
按照端口优先级,设备通过一一映射为报文分配相应的优先级。
配置了信任报文模式后,本命令的配置不生效。
【举例】
# 配置无线服务模板1的端口优先级为2。
<Sysname> system
[Sysname] wlan service-template 1
[Sysname-wlan-st-1] qos priority 2
【相关命令】
· qos trust
qos trust命令用来配置信任报文优先级的类型。
undo qos trust命令用来恢复缺省情况。
【命令】
qos trust { dot11e | dscp }
undo qos trust
【缺省情况】
设备信任端口优先级。
【视图】
无线服务模板视图
【缺省用户角色】
network-admin
【参数】
dot11e:信任802.11报文携带的802.11e优先级,以此优先级进行优先级映射。
dscp:信任802.11报文携带的DSCP优先级,以此优先级进行优先级映射。
【使用指导】
信任端口优先级和信任报文优先级都只对上行报文有效。
若无线服务模板下配置了信任某类型的报文优先级,则设备根据此类型的优先级对报文进行优先级映射,否则按照端口优先级进行优先级映射。
【举例】
# 配置无线服务模板1信任802.11报文携带的802.11e优先级。
<Sysname> system
[Sysname] wlan service-template 1
[Sysname-wlan-st-1] qos trust dot11e
【相关命令】
· qos priority
reset wlan wmm命令用来清除WMM统计信息。
【命令】
reset wlan wmm { client [ interface wlan-radio interface-number | mac-address mac-address ] | radio [ interface wlan-radio interface-number ] }
【视图】
用户视图
【缺省用户角色】
network-admin
【参数】
client:清除WMM客户端的统计信息。不指定interface wlan-radio和mac-address参数表示清除所有WMM客户端的统计信息。
radio:清除WMM射频的统计信息。不指定interface wlan-radio参数表示清除所有WMM射频的统计信息。
mac-address mac-address:清除指定MAC地址的WMM客户端统计信息,mac-address格式为H-H-H。
interface wlan-radio interface-number:清除指定射频接口的WMM客户端/WMM射频统计信息。
【举例】
# 清除所有WMM射频的统计信息。
<Sysname> reset wlan wmm radio
【相关命令】
· display wlan wmm
svp map-ac命令用来开启高优先级队列的SVP映射功能。
svp map-ac disable命令用来关闭高优先级队列的SVP映射功能。
undo svp map-ac命令用来恢复缺省情况。
【命令】
svp map-ac { ac-vi | ac-vo }
svp map-ac disable
undo svp map-ac
【缺省情况】
高优先级队列的SVP映射功能处于关闭状态。
【视图】
Radio接口视图
【缺省用户角色】
network-admin
【参数】
ac-vi:开启AC-VI队列的SVP映射功能,将SVP报文放入AC-VI队列。
ac-vo:开启AC-VO队列的SVP映射功能,将SVP报文放入AC-VO队列。
【使用指导】
SVP映射只针对非WMM客户端接入,对WMM客户端不起作用。
【举例】
# 开启AC-VO队列的SVP映射功能,将SVP报文放入AC-VO队列中。
<Sysname> system-view
[Sysname] interface wlan-radio 0/0
[Sysname-WLAN-Radio0/0] svp map-ac ac-vo
wmm enable命令用来开启WMM功能。
wmm disable命令用来关闭WMM功能。
undo wmm命令用来恢复缺省情况。
【命令】
wmm { disable | enable }
undo wmm
【缺省情况】
WMM功能处于开启状态。
【视图】
Radio接口视图
【缺省用户角色】
network-admin
【参数】
disable:关闭WMM功能。
enable:开启WMM功能。
【使用指导】
802.11n的客户端必须支持WLAN QoS,所以当Radio工作在802.11an或802.11gn的情况下,必须开启WMM功能,否则可能会导致关联后的802.11n的客户端无法通信。
【举例】
# 关闭WMM功能。
<Sysname> system-view
[Sysname] interface wlan-radio 0/0
[Sysname-WLAN-Radio0/0] wmm disable
不同款型规格的资料略有差异, 详细信息请向具体销售和400咨询。H3C保留在没有任何通知或提示的情况下对资料内容进行修改的权利!